- •Лабораторная работа №1. Изучение базовых понятий программирования и технологии создания программ.
- •Лабораторное задание
- •Теоретические сведения.
- •Данные : переменные и константы.
- •Выражения.
- •Оператор присваивания.
- •Преобразование типов.
- •Препроцессор языка с.
- •Директива #include.
- •Директива # define.
- •Этапы трансляции программы.
- •Структура программы на языке с.
- •Основные пункты меню и их назначение
- •Создание нового проекта.
- •Написание и компиляция простейшей программы.
- •Примеры программирования.
- •Вопросы.
Основные пункты меню и их назначение
Меню File содержит команды для манипулирования файлами.
Режим |
Кнопка на панели |
«Горячие» клавиши |
Назначение |
New |
|
Ctrl+N |
Создать новый проект или текстовый файл |
Open |
|
Ctrl+O |
Открыть созданный ранее файл (поместить его в окно редактирования) |
Save |
|
Ctrl+S |
Сохранить на диске файл из текущего окна редактирования |
Save All |
|
- |
Сохранить все файлы проекта. |
Exit |
|
- |
Выйти из MVC |
Меню Edit позволяет редактировать текст. Работа этих команд аналогична командам в большинстве текстовых редакторов. Ниже приведены наиболее часто используемые команды.
Режим |
Кнопка на панели |
«Горячие» клавиши |
Назначение |
Copy |
|
Ctrl+C |
Копирование выделенного блока текста в буфер обмена |
Cut |
|
Ctrl+Z |
Перемещение выделенного блока текста в буфер обмена |
Paste |
|
Ctrl+V |
Извлечение блока текста из буфера обмена |
Delete |
|
Del |
Удаление выделенного блока текста |
Меню Build содержит команды, предназначенные для трансляции текста программы, а также отладки и запуска созданной вами программы.
Режим |
Кнопка на панели |
«Горячие» клавиши |
Назначение |
Go |
|
F5 |
Компиляция и запуск программы на выполнение |
Execute |
|
Ctrl+F5 |
Запуск программы на выполнение |
Compile |
|
Ctrl+F7 |
Компиляция текущего файла проекта (создание .obj файла) |
Build |
|
F7 |
Сборка программы из файлов проекта (создание .exe файла) |
Step into |
|
F11 |
Пошаговое выполнение программы с "заходом" в функции |
Меню View содержит команды, позволяющие настроить внешний вид рабочего пространства MVC.
Меню Insert содержит команды, позволяющие вставлять в проект новые файлы, ресурсы, объекты и тому подобное.
Меню Project. Команды меню Project позволяют управлять открытыми проектами.
Меню Tools содержит команды вызова вспомогательных утилит, программирования макросов и настройки среды MVC.
Создание нового проекта.
Приступая к работе над новой программой необходимо создать новый проект. Для этого выполните следующие действия :
В меню File задайте команду New...
В открывшемся диалоговом окне New выберите вкладку Projects
Укажите тип проекта. В нашем случае это будет простое консольное приложение — Win32 ConsoleApplication.
Введите имя файла проекта в поле Project name, например Лаб1 , а в поле Location – путь к папке, в которой будут храниться файлы проекта.
Нажмете кнопку ОК, отобразится окно с набором опций:
An empty project
A simple application
A “hellow, world!” application
An application, that supports MFS
Следует выбрать режим A simple application. После нажатия кнопки «Finish» новый проект будет создан.
Рассмотрим окно нового проекта – оно состоит из двух частей: слева располагается панель управления проектом, а справа окно для создания текста программы. Панель управления проектом вызывается командой View/Workspace и состоит из двух закладок:
«Class view» отображает информацию о функциях и переменных проекта. Двойной щелчок по названию функции открывает в рабочем файле место с объявлением этой функции.
«File view» отображает информацию о рабочих файлах проекта.Двойной щелчок по названию файла откроет окно редактирования этого файла.